โœฆ Synopsis


This invention relates to a highpressure seal that is designed for use as a radial seal. It comprises an antiextrusion ring (3) and a sealing ring (5). It is claimed to produce a reliable seal between the two housing components (18, 19), even at pressures of 1600 bar.
